解决ModuleNotFoundError: No module named pip错误
在使用pip命令进行更新时,有时候会出现ModuleNotFoundError: No module named 'pip'错误的提示,导致无法正常使用pip命令。此时,我们可以按照以下步骤来修复这个问题。
步骤1:尝试执行pip install --upgrade pip命令
首先,在执行pip install --upgrade pip命令时如果遇到了更新失败或警告的情况,并且再次使用pip命令时报错"No module named 'pip'",我们需要采取下一步操作。
步骤2:以管理员权限打开一个新的cmd命令窗口
我们需要重新打开一个cmd命令窗口,并选择使用管理员权限运行。可以通过右键点击cmd图标,然后选择“以管理员身份运行”来实现这一步骤。
步骤3:执行python -m ensurepip命令
在打开的管理员权限的cmd命令窗口中,输入并执行以下命令:python -m ensurepip
请直接复制该命令并按回车执行。
步骤4:检查是否成功安装ensurepip
当您在执行上述命令后,如果提示"Successfully installed..",则表示ensurepip安装成功。
步骤5:执行python -m pip install --upgrade pip命令
在确保ensurepip已成功安装之后,我们需要继续执行以下命令:python -m pip install --upgrade pip
同样地,请复制该命令并按回车执行。
步骤6:检查是否成功更新pip
当您在执行上述命令后,如果提示"Successfully installed...",则表示pip已成功更新。
总结
因此,当您在执行pip更新时出现失败或警告,并在再次执行pip命令时报错时,您可以按照以下顺序执行命令来修复问题:
1. python -m ensurepip
2. python -m pip install --upgrade pip
通过以上步骤,您将能够解决ModuleNotFoundError: No module named 'pip'错误,并继续正常使用pip命令。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。